Application

Catalyst for hydrogenation of various functional groups with minimal hydrogenolysis problems; used as dehydrogenation catalyst; used for selective oxidation of primary alcohols.
Catalyst for:
  • Hydrohydrazination reactions
  • Oxidation of sugars
  • Low-temperature oxidation of carbon monoxide
  • Oxygen reduction reaction
  • Hydrogenation reactions
  • Hydrogenolysis of the cyclopropyl group into an isopropyl group
  • Hydroxycyclopropanation reactions
Platinum(IV) oxide has been used for the reduction of citernyl bromide to form (S)-3,7-dimethyloctylbromide.[1]
